The registered owner is responsible for all towing, storage, lien, and release fees. Pursuant to Section 22852 of the California Vehicle Code, you have the right to an administrative hearing to determine the validity of the storage. No cash will be accepted. If a towed vehicle is subject to a 30-day impound due to the driver being unlicensed or having a suspended license, the vehicle may be released prior to the 30th day, if the driver of the vehicle at the time of impound obtains a valid driver's license from DMV.
